NCB QUISK makes refreshing deal with Island Grill

-

NCB QUISK has partnered with Island Grill to give customers a refreshing drink this (still) new year. The promotion, which runs until March 31, 2018, gives Island Grill customers who use NCB QUISK to pay for their meals a complement­ary REFRESHER drink.

NCB’s Gregory Peart, sales and relationsh­ip manager, said that the bank’s partnershi­p with Island Grill is long-standing, as the restaurant chain was one of the first merchants to start utilising the mobile money solution.

In explaining the idea behind the partnershi­p, Peart stated that the promotion was born out of NCB’s desire to give customers tangible value for their continued support, and to establish NCB QUISK as top of mind in the mobile money space.

“This partnershi­p gives us the opportunit­y to give back to our customers and thank them for their continued support,” he said.

NCB QUISK is an electronic payment solution which allows customers to make purchases and conduct other transactio­ns using their mobile phones. The technology allows any Jamaican with a mobile number on any network to securely access their money quickly and easily without needing cash, cards, or even the phone.

“The sign-up process is very easy and requires minimal personal informatio­n. The greatest benefit is that the applicatio­n offers users a great sense of convenienc­e and security by allowing them to make transactio­ns without the need for cash, card or even their phone, for that matter,” Peart said.

The mobile money solution, which leverages the bank’s existing point-of-sale infrastruc­ture works on any network carrier across the island and is accessible using any mobile phone.

Customers can transfer and receive funds from family and friends, pay participat­ing merchants, add funds using NCB iABMs, and withdraw money at any NCB ABM whether or not their phone is on-hand, as all they need to remember are their 10-digit mobile number and sixdigit PIN.

In the near future, the bank will roll out new features including bill payments and phone top-up capabiliti­es.
